Assessment of ADD by means of tests
There are a variety of tests for adults to add assessment. They are designed to detect attention problems and impulsivity. An extensive evaluation should consist of standardized behavior rating scales for ADHD and interviews with the patient.
FDA-cleared computer tests like the Test of Variables of Attention are used to screen for ADHD. It measures visual and auditory processing abilities. This test is conducted by both adults and children for 21.6 minutes. They are given basic geometric shapes to use as targets during the test. They have to press a micro switch whenever the target is displayed. They shouldn't press the micro switch if they are hearing a toneor other signal.
A previous study found that ADHD patients scored lower on tests of impulsivity and inattention than people without the condition. This led to the conclusion that tests aren't effective at diagnosing ADHD in adults.
The Quantified Behavior Test (QbTest) is a mixture of impulsivity and attention tests and motion tracking analysis. It can be used as an a medical instrument to assess the effects of stimulant medications. It can also be used to detect fidgetiness. In addition, it can provide information on the effectiveness of neurofeedback training.
Another test that is called the IVA CPT, is designed to distinguish ADHD from conduct disorder. During the test, the subject wears a headband with an infrared marker. Each stimulus is followed by an void of the same duration. Once the error of the patient's commission is detected, the time it takes the patient to react to the next stimulus is measured. After the test has been completed, a report is generated.
